    GAME 1: # 22 Georgia @ # 24 South Carolina - The Gamecocks & QB Stephen Garcia looked impressive in their home opener against Southern Miss, while my beloved DAWGS and true freshman QB Aaron Murray, looked equally impressive in their home opener against a weak Ragin' Cajuns club.  The Bulldogs visit as road-dogs, having won 7 of their last 8 vs. the Cocks, including 4 straight in Columbia, and I say they make it 5 in this SEC classic.  GEORGIA - 24, SOUTH CAROLINA - 21.

    GAME 2: # 12 Miami @ # 2 Ohio State - I love Miami QB Jacory Harris, and the Canes are my early favorite to take the ACC title, but Terrelle Pryor is equally as lovable, and won't be denied at the Shoe.  Miami may cover the 9.5 spread, but Ohio State will win this game.  OHIO STATE - 35, MIAMI - 28.

    GAME 3: # 17 Florida State @ # 10 Oklahoma - The Sooners are basking (just a little) in the glow of their week # 1 win - the teams 800th of all-time, and I see # 801 coming against what will be a tough Florida State Seminole team.  FSU QB Christian Ponder will not fare as well against OU, as he did against Samford last week.  Jimbo Fisher suffers first tough loss as new head coach in a nail biter.  OKLAHOMA - 33, FLORIDA STATE - 30.

    GAME 4: # 18 Penn State @ # 1 Alabama - Upset special?  Nah.  I love Jo-Pa and Nittany Lion wideout Brett Brackett, but BAMA is flat out loaded.  I don't think true frosh QB Robert Bolden will handle the pressure at Tuscaloosa.  It's highly likely that last year's Heisman winner Mark Ingram will not see action again on Saturday, but it won't matter.  Senior QB Greg McElroy and Trent Richardson will lead the Tide to victory - a BIG victory. ALABAMA - 32, PENN STATE -14.

    GAME 5: Michigan @ Notre Dame - No ranked teams here, but hugely compelling none the less.  "Rookie" Notre Dame coach Brian Kelly has a nice win over Purdue under his belt, and the Irish are looking to avenge last year's painful loss to Big Blue (came back from 11 points down in 4th qtr., only to yield winning score with 11 seconds on the clock).  On the other side you have coach Rich Rodriguez with a big win over a very tough Connecticut team in the Wolverine home opener.  Despite the victory, Rodriguez is on the hot seat EVERY week this season, and a 2-0 start will certainly take much of that heat off.  It ain't coming off.  I'm going with "The Luck of The Irish" as well as the pundits in Vegas on this one.  NOTRE DAME - 24, MICHIGAN - 20.
